>>The NSW Premier's Literary Awards (an Australia-wide award despite its title)
>>short list was announced this morning and the books short-listed for the
>>Kenneth Slessor Prize for Poetry included:
>>
>>Jill Jones for Screens Jets Heaven
>>
>>as well as:
>>
>>Alison Croggon, Attempts at Being
>>
>>Others books on the short list were:
>>
>>Kate Lilley, Versary
>>Emma Lew, Anything the Landlord Touches
>>Sarah Day, New and Selected Poems
>>Robert Gray, Afterimages
